Quick Creamy Banana Oatmeal

Make creamy, naturally sweet oatmeal on the stovetop using ripe bananas for flavor and texture. This recipe is fast and requires no added sugar.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up rolled oats
  • 2 cups water or milk (dairy or non-dairy)
  • 1 large very ripe banana, mashed
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 tablespoon chia seeds (optional, for thickness)

Instructions

  1. Combine the oats, water or milk, cinnamon, and salt in a small saucepan.
  2. Bring the mixture to a gentle boil over medium heat, stirring occasionally.
  3. Reduce the heat to low and let it simmer for 5 to 7 minutes, stirring frequently until the oats absorb most of the liquid and become creamy.
  4. Remove the saucepan from the heat. Immediately stir in the mashed banana and chia seeds, if using.
  5. Stir vigorously for one minute to fully incorporate the banana, which will make the oatmeal extra creamy.
  6. Serve immediately.

Notes

  • Use very ripe bananas; the browner the peel, the sweeter the flavor.
  • For a thicker texture, use less liquid or cook for an extra minute.
  • Add a splash of vanilla extract at the end for deeper flavor.
  • Top with sliced nuts or a drizzle of peanut butter before serving.
